Abstract

The added mass of a group of circular sections in a confined fluid has been studied in many references. This note revisits this problem and aims to reveal some essential results that have not been well studied previously but indicate a general conclusion of the added mass coefficients. The sum of the added mass coefficients of one section caused by all boundaries’ motions along the same direction is equal to the constant value \(-1\); however, the sum of the coefficients perpendicular to the motion direction is the constant value 0. Given this conclusion, this present study extends the previous models to a group of arbitrary sections in a confined fluid for a more general analysis. The conclusion mentioned above is still available for the present modeling and shows generality. According to the principle of superposition, this paper gives concise and strict proof of this conclusion. This general conclusion of fluid added mass can serve as an essential reference for other studies of such a problem.
